Job searching can be overwhelming. You are not alone. We are here for you. Project EM is a national initiative bringing Jewish human service agencies together to provide support to job seekers. Project EM is designed to operate in a holistic manner, recognizing that each job seeker is an individual and each job search is important.
Join our interactive workshops, technical skills training, financial literacy sessions, stress reduction classes, and more. These virtual experiences are here to help you develop your skills, grow as a professional, and showcase the best you have to offer.

Project EM is an offering of the Network of Jewish Human Service Agencies, in partnership with The Jewish Federations of North America.
